30 The lsvpd package contains both the lsvpd, lscfg and lsmcode commands.
31 These commands, along with a boot-time scanning script called
32 update-device-tree, constitute a simple hardware inventory system. The
33 lsvpd command provides Vital Product Data (VPD) about hardware
34 components to higher-level serviceability tools. The lscfg command
35 provides a more human-readable format of the VPD, as well as some
36 system-specific information. lsmcode lists microcode and firmware
